    There's literally zero evidence of this.

    Anyone who believes there is currently any evidence that proves these treatments are beneficial toward Covid-19 don't understand the difference between correlation and causation.

    "We gave people this and some of them got better" =/= "they got better because we gave them this"

    Hence, the clinic trials to provide better understood results, but certainly not something that should be called a "game changer" nor a "potential game changer" by one of the most influential people on the planet on national television.

    Because, again, for the third time, stuff like that causes people to unnecessarily hoard it from people who actually need it, and it causes people to overdose on it and die, again, both of which have already happened.

    Seasonal Flu has a "Basic Reproduction Number" of 1.3. This number is the average number of people that an infected person can infect.

    Measles, one of the most contagious viruses is 12-18. Zika was 3-6.6.

    COVID-19 is 2-2.5 right now.

    Basic math makes after 10 rounds of "infection" (1 person gets 1 sick, that person gets 2 sick to total as 4 ppl sick in 3 rounds). Seasonal flu sits at like 50-60ppl infected. COVID-19 is 2,000+.

    When you're infectious with COVID-19, you typically start to show symptoms 5 days after catching it, sometimes up to 10-14 days after catching. Also known as the incubation period. And scientists think you're contagious during this period. The seasonal flu incubation period, 1-2 days. You get sick, you feel sick, you take precautions to prevent the spread. This is what we're used to. We are used to being contagious when we feel sick. Unlike COVID-19 when you are spreading it potentially, when you feel fine.

    Now during this "incubation period" with the flu, you spend 1 day potentially spreading it to the population, however, since our bodies have potentially seen the flu before some people could have an immunity to the flu virus. Either through a flu shot, or they've had this strain of flu before. This is big, because if I'm sick and the seasonal flu virus from myself gets on 4 people in a day, 3 of the 4 people could have an immunity to this flu virus, and the 4th could not catch it. Then the same goes with that person. This is why doctors urge people to get the flu vaccine, not necessarily to block yourself from it, but to prevent the spread of the flu virus. Now pretty much no one has a COVID-19 immunity, it spreads, and nothing stops it, and it is twice as contagious as the seasonal flu.

    Next, 2% of people with seasonal flu need to be hospitalized, COVID-19...it's 20-30%. COVID-19 fatality rate...1-3%. The seasonal flu...0.1%. COVID-19 is 10-30x higher across ALL age groups. That numbers jumps with the older you are (potentially).

    So you have a virus, that has a Basic Reproduction Number twice the flu, 10x longer time period between when you catch it and when you start to show symptoms, no one has an immunity to it, it puts people in the hospital 10-15x more than the flu, 10-30x deadlier than the flu, and there's no cure or vaccine for it. And the seasonal flu has a vaccine.

    The only cure we have right now, is social. Socially, we gotta take ourselves out of the equation. The above is supposed to show how contagious this COVID-19 is, and the fact we don't know who has it right now. I talked about how one of the reasons why doctors urge the world to get flu shots not to block yourself from getting the flu, but to take yourself out of the equation of spreading it. Social Distancing is the current COVID-19 vaccine. We all have to remove ourselves from the equation to make it effective.

    Comparing COVID-19 to the flu makes sense. Both have the same symptoms, both are viruses, we've had previous coronaviruses in the past (MERS, SARS). Naturally we want to call it something we know to shield us from reality of the seriousness. But we gotta stop thinking it's the flu still. We need to continue/start social distancing.
